/netbsd-src/external/apache2/llvm/dist/llvm/lib/CodeGen/SelectionDAG/ |
H A D | LegalizeFloatTypes.cpp | 158 EVT NVT = TLI.getTypeToTransformTo(*DAG.getContext(), N->getValueType(0)); in SoftenFloatRes_Unary() 177 EVT NVT = TLI.getTypeToTransformTo(*DAG.getContext(), N->getValueType(0)); in SoftenFloatRes_Binary() 201 EVT Ty = TLI.getTypeToTransformTo(*DAG.getContext(), N->getValueType(0)); in SoftenFloatRes_FREEZE() 215 TLI.getTypeToTransformTo(*DAG.getContext(), in SoftenFloatRes_BUILD_PAIR() 236 TLI.getTypeToTransformTo(*DAG.getContext(), in SoftenFloatRes_ConstantFP() 240 TLI.getTypeToTransformTo(*DAG.getContext(), in SoftenFloatRes_ConstantFP() 253 EVT NVT = TLI.getTypeToTransformTo(*DAG.getContext(), N->getValueType(0)); in SoftenFloatRes_FABS() 431 EVT NVT = TLI.getTypeToTransformTo(*DAG.getContext(), N->getValueType(0)); in SoftenFloatRes_FMA() 474 EVT NVT = TLI.getTypeToTransformTo(*DAG.getContext(), N->getValueType(0)); in SoftenFloatRes_FNEG() 485 EVT NVT = TLI.getTypeToTransformTo(*DAG.getContext(), N->getValueType(0)); in SoftenFloatRes_FP_EXTEND() [all …]
|
H A D | LegalizeTypesGeneric.cpp | 42 EVT NOutVT = TLI.getTypeToTransformTo(*DAG.getContext(), OutVT); in ExpandRes_BITCAST() 219 EVT NewVT = TLI.getTypeToTransformTo(*DAG.getContext(), OldVT); in ExpandRes_EXTRACT_VECTOR_ELT() 257 EVT NVT = TLI.getTypeToTransformTo(*DAG.getContext(), ValueVT); in ExpandRes_NormalLoad() 291 EVT NVT = TLI.getTypeToTransformTo(*DAG.getContext(), OVT); in ExpandRes_VAARG() 350 TLI.getTypeToTransformTo(*DAG.getContext(), OVT), in ExpandOp_BITCAST() 376 EVT NewVT = TLI.getTypeToTransformTo(*DAG.getContext(), OldVT); in ExpandOp_BUILD_VECTOR() 417 EVT NewEVT = TLI.getTypeToTransformTo(*DAG.getContext(), OldEVT); in ExpandOp_INSERT_VECTOR_ELT() 467 EVT NVT = TLI.getTypeToTransformTo(*DAG.getContext(), ValueVT); in ExpandOp_NormalStore()
|
H A D | LegalizeTypes.cpp | 704 TLI.getTypeToTransformTo(*DAG.getContext(), Op.getValueType()) && in SetPromotedInteger() 718 TLI.getTypeToTransformTo(*DAG.getContext(), Op.getValueType()) && in SetSoftenedFloat() 729 TLI.getTypeToTransformTo(*DAG.getContext(), Op.getValueType()) && in SetPromotedFloat() 775 TLI.getTypeToTransformTo(*DAG.getContext(), Op.getValueType()) && in SetExpandedInteger() 812 TLI.getTypeToTransformTo(*DAG.getContext(), Op.getValueType()) && in SetExpandedFloat() 855 TLI.getTypeToTransformTo(*DAG.getContext(), Op.getValueType()) && in SetWidenedVector() 979 EVT NVT = TLI.getTypeToTransformTo(*DAG.getContext(), Pair.getValueType()); in GetPairElements()
|
H A D | LegalizeIntegerTypes.cpp | 261 EVT ResVT = TLI.getTypeToTransformTo(*DAG.getContext(), N->getValueType(0)); in PromoteIntRes_Atomic0() 289 EVT NVT = TLI.getTypeToTransformTo(*DAG.getContext(), N->getValueType(1)); in PromoteIntRes_AtomicCmpSwap() 338 EVT NInVT = TLI.getTypeToTransformTo(*DAG.getContext(), InVT); in PromoteIntRes_BITCAST() 340 EVT NOutVT = TLI.getTypeToTransformTo(*DAG.getContext(), OutVT); in PromoteIntRes_BITCAST() 505 TLI.getTypeToTransformTo(*DAG.getContext(), in PromoteIntRes_BUILD_PAIR() 518 TLI.getTypeToTransformTo(*DAG.getContext(), VT), in PromoteIntRes_Constant() 562 EVT NVT = TLI.getTypeToTransformTo(*DAG.getContext(), N->getValueType(0)); in PromoteIntRes_EXTRACT_VECTOR_ELT() 586 EVT NVT = TLI.getTypeToTransformTo(*DAG.getContext(), N->getValueType(0)); in PromoteIntRes_FP_TO_XINT() 629 EVT NVT = TLI.getTypeToTransformTo(*DAG.getContext(), N->getValueType(0)); in PromoteIntRes_FP_TO_XINT_SAT() 636 EVT NVT = TLI.getTypeToTransformTo(*DAG.getContext(), N->getValueType(0)); in PromoteIntRes_FP_TO_FP16() [all …]
|
H A D | LegalizeVectorTypes.cpp | 3127 EVT WideVecVT = TLI.getTypeToTransformTo(*DAG.getContext(), VT); in WidenVectorResult() 3167 EVT WidenVT = TLI.getTypeToTransformTo(*DAG.getContext(), N->getValueType(0)); in WidenVecRes_Ternary() 3177 EVT WidenVT = TLI.getTypeToTransformTo(*DAG.getContext(), N->getValueType(0)); in WidenVecRes_Binary() 3186 EVT WidenVT = TLI.getTypeToTransformTo(*DAG.getContext(), N->getValueType(0)); in WidenVecRes_BinaryWithExtraScalarOp() 3278 EVT WidenVT = TLI.getTypeToTransformTo(*DAG.getContext(), N->getValueType(0)); in WidenVecRes_BinaryCanTrap() 3365 EVT WidenVT = TLI.getTypeToTransformTo(*DAG.getContext(), N->getValueType(0)); in WidenVecRes_StrictFP() 3478 WideResVT = TLI.getTypeToTransformTo(*DAG.getContext(), ResVT); in WidenVecRes_OverflowOp() 3486 WideOvVT = TLI.getTypeToTransformTo(*DAG.getContext(), OvVT); in WidenVecRes_OverflowOp() 3524 EVT WidenVT = TLI.getTypeToTransformTo(Ctx, N->getValueType(0)); in WidenVecRes_Convert() 3536 TLI.getTypeToTransformTo(Ctx, InVT).getScalarSizeInBits() != in WidenVecRes_Convert() [all …]
|
H A D | FunctionLoweringInfo.cpp | 448 IntVT = TLI->getTypeToTransformTo(PN->getContext(), IntVT); in ComputePHILiveOutRegInfo()
|
H A D | FastISel.cpp | 254 VT = TLI.getTypeToTransformTo(V->getContext(), VT).getSimpleVT(); in getRegForValue() 467 VT = TLI.getTypeToTransformTo(I->getContext(), VT); in selectBinaryOp()
|
H A D | SelectionDAG.cpp | 1374 EltVT = TLI->getTypeToTransformTo(*getContext(), EltVT); in getConstant() 1388 EVT ViaEltVT = TLI->getTypeToTransformTo(*getContext(), EltVT); in getConstant() 2647 LegalSVT = TLI->getTypeToTransformTo(*getContext(), LegalSVT); in getSplatValue() 5202 LegalSVT = TLI->getTypeToTransformTo(*getContext(), LegalSVT); in FoldConstantArithmetic() 5330 LegalSVT = TLI->getTypeToTransformTo(*getContext(), LegalSVT); in FoldConstantVectorArithmetic() 6442 EVT NVT = TLI.getTypeToTransformTo(C, VT); in getMemcpyLoadsAndStores() 10104 LoVT = HiVT = TLI->getTypeToTransformTo(*getContext(), VT); in GetSplitDestVTs()
|
H A D | LegalizeDAG.cpp | 651 TLI.getTypeToTransformTo(*DAG.getContext(), StVT), in LegalizeStoreOps() 3007 EVT NewEltVT = TLI.getTypeToTransformTo(*DAG.getContext(), EltVT); in ExpandNode()
|
H A D | DAGCombiner.cpp | 9181 EVT TransformVT = TLI.getTypeToTransformTo(*DAG.getContext(), VT); in combineMinNumMaxNum() 16858 TLI.getTypeToTransformTo(*DAG.getContext(), StoredVal.getValueType()); in mergeStoresOfConstantsOrVecElts() 17193 TLI.getTypeToTransformTo(Context, StoredVal.getValueType()); in tryStoreMergeOfConstants() 17462 EVT LegalizedStoredValTy = TLI.getTypeToTransformTo(Context, StoreTy); in tryStoreMergeOfLoads() 17572 TLI.getTypeToTransformTo(*DAG.getContext(), JointMemOpVT); in tryStoreMergeOfLoads()
|
H A D | TargetLowering.cpp | 5116 MulVT = getTypeToTransformTo(*DAG.getContext(), VT); in BuildSDIV() 5264 MulVT = getTypeToTransformTo(*DAG.getContext(), VT); in BuildUDIV()
|
H A D | SelectionDAGBuilder.cpp | 3274 VT = TLI.getTypeToTransformTo(Ctx, VT); in visitSelect() 11025 TLI.getTypeToTransformTo(*DAG.getContext(), ResultVT.getScalarType()); in visitStepVector()
|
/netbsd-src/external/apache2/llvm/dist/llvm/lib/CodeGen/ |
H A D | TypePromotion.cpp | 985 EVT PromotedVT = TLI->getTypeToTransformTo(ICmp->getContext(), SrcVT); in runOnFunction()
|
H A D | TargetLoweringBase.cpp | 1517 EVT RegisterEVT = getTypeToTransformTo(Context, VT); in getVectorTypeBreakdown()
|
H A D | CodeGenPrepare.cpp | 1296 SrcVT = TLI.getTypeToTransformTo(CI->getContext(), SrcVT); in OptimizeNoopCopyExpression() 1299 DstVT = TLI.getTypeToTransformTo(CI->getContext(), DstVT); in OptimizeNoopCopyExpression()
|
/netbsd-src/external/apache2/llvm/dist/llvm/include/llvm/CodeGen/ |
H A D | TargetLowering.h | 936 EVT getTypeToTransformTo(LLVMContext &Context, EVT VT) const { in getTypeToTransformTo() function 951 VT = getTypeToTransformTo(Context, VT); in getTypeToExpandTo() 1462 return getRegisterType(Context, getTypeToTransformTo(Context, VT)); in getRegisterType()
|
/netbsd-src/external/apache2/llvm/dist/llvm/lib/Target/Hexagon/ |
H A D | HexagonISelLoweringHVX.cpp | 1275 EVT NTy = getTypeToTransformTo(*DAG.getContext(), Ty); in LowerHvxConcatVectors() 1967 EVT RetTy = getTypeToTransformTo(*DAG.getContext(), ty(Op)); in WidenHvxSetCC() 2291 EVT WideTy = getTypeToTransformTo(*DAG.getContext(), Ty); in shouldWidenToHvx()
|
H A D | HexagonISelDAGToDAGHVX.cpp | 1442 MVT LegalTy = Lower.getTypeToTransformTo(Ctx, ElemTy).getSimpleVT(); in scalarizeShuffle()
|
/netbsd-src/external/apache2/llvm/dist/llvm/lib/Target/VE/ |
H A D | VEISelLowering.cpp | 2700 EVT LegalVecVT = getTypeToTransformTo(*DAG.getContext(), OpVecVT); in lowerToVVP()
|
/netbsd-src/external/apache2/llvm/dist/llvm/lib/Target/X86/ |
H A D | X86ISelLowering.cpp | 2224 LegalVT = getTypeToTransformTo(Context, LegalVT); in getSetCCResultType() 5315 VT = getTypeToTransformTo(Context, VT); in decomposeMulByConstant() 24267 EVT WideVT = TLI.getTypeToTransformTo(*DAG.getContext(), StoreVT); in LowerStore() 29998 EVT WideVT = TLI.getTypeToTransformTo(*DAG.getContext(), VT); in LowerMSCATTER() 30544 EVT ResVT = getTypeToTransformTo(*DAG.getContext(), VT); in ReplaceNodeResults() 30565 MVT WidenVT = getTypeToTransformTo(*DAG.getContext(), VT).getSimpleVT(); in ReplaceNodeResults() 30671 InVT = getTypeToTransformTo(*DAG.getContext(), InVT); in ReplaceNodeResults() 31196 EVT WideVT = getTypeToTransformTo(*DAG.getContext(), DstVT); in ReplaceNodeResults() 31216 EVT WideVT = getTypeToTransformTo(*DAG.getContext(), VT); in ReplaceNodeResults() 31259 EVT WideVT = getTypeToTransformTo(*DAG.getContext(), VT); in ReplaceNodeResults()
|
/netbsd-src/external/apache2/llvm/dist/llvm/lib/Target/AMDGPU/ |
H A D | AMDGPUISelLowering.cpp | 3417 EVT LegalVT = getTypeToTransformTo(*DAG.getContext(), VT); in getFFBX_U32()
|
/netbsd-src/external/apache2/llvm/dist/llvm/lib/Target/AArch64/ |
H A D | AArch64ISelLowering.cpp | 13798 EVT OutVT = TLI.getTypeToTransformTo(*DAG.getContext(), VT); in getPTest()
|